Medical Education

One of the primary objectives of ACOG District II (ACOG) is to create a platform for women’s health care that is consistent with the needs of New York’s diverse population. ACOG has initiated a wide range of public education and continuing medical education activities with the express aim of improving and maintaining quality health care for women.
